Texas & Arizona – From the Edge of Slaughter to the Promise of a New Life

ree
ree

Before Second Chance Farm

 

Texas and Arizona were both over 20 years old when we met them — two souls standing in the dust of a Texas holding facility, hours away from being shipped to slaughter in Mexico.

 

They were completely emaciated, in shock, barely moving. Their eyes were tired, their bodies frail, and their spirits seemed gone. They had less than two hours to be saved.


Their Journey to Healing

 

The moment they arrived, our veterinary team went to work. They received bloodwork, X-rays, teeth floating, hoof care, and every possible treatment to start their recovery.

 

They were given not only food and medical attention, but also a safe place to rest, a calm environment, and the gentle reassurance that their lives mattered.


Today: Stronger in Body and Spirit

 

Just four months later, the transformation is remarkable. Both Texas and Arizona have gained significant weight, their coats are healthier, and their eyes now carry a spark of curiosity. Emotionally, they’ve come back to life — enjoying the company of other horses and learning to trust again.

 

They are still at the sanctuary, continuing their recovery. When they are fully ready, our hope is to find them a loving home together, where they can live out their days in peace.
